Solve it like a normal quadratic equation and take the root of the roots
x^4 + 10x^2 + 25 = 0
Δ = b² - 4.a.c
Δ = 10² - 4 . 1 . 25
Δ = 100 - 4. 1 . 25
Δ = 0
1 real root.
In this case, x' = x'':
x = (-b +- √Δ)/2a
x' = (-10 + √0)/2.1
x'' = (-10 - √0)/2.1
x' = -10 / 2
x'' = -10 / 2
x' = -5
x'' = -5
Now take the root of this roots
√-5 = i√5
The root of this equation is x = ±i√5

Step-by-step explanation:
The question asks to calculate the contribution margin for the month of March.
The contribution margin is mathematically calculated as the selling price per unit minus the variable cost per unit
According to the parameters in this particular question, the contribution margin is selling price - total variable cost = 160,000 - 95,000 = $65,000
